本文目录导读:
如何高效利用WPS VBA进行数据处理与自动化操作
在现代办公环境中,WPS Office凭借其强大的功能和便捷的操作流程逐渐成为企业员工的重要工具,为了提升工作效率,许多用户开始探索如何通过VBA(Visual Basic for Applications)实现更高级的数据处理和自动化任务,本文将详细介绍如何下载并安装WPS VBA插件,并提供一些实用的教程,帮助您充分利用这一强大功能。
目录导读
-
- WPS VBA的优势
- 高效数据处理的关键
-
下载WPS VBA插件
- 安装步骤详解
- 插件常见问题解决指南
-
基本VBA编程基础
- 创建第一个VBA宏
- 使用宏执行基本操作
-
实际应用案例
- 数据筛选与排序
- 自动生成报告模板
-
总结与展望
随着技术的发展,越来越多的企业开始采用现代化办公软件如WPS Office来提高工作效率,而作为一款强大的Office套件之一,WPS VBA插件为用户提供了一个更为灵活和强大的数据处理平台,本文将从下载、安装以及基本的VBA编程入手,带领读者深入探讨如何有效利用WPS VBA进行数据处理与自动化操作。
下载WPS VBA插件
下载步骤:
- 访问官网:请访问【https://www.wps.com.cn/】进入WPS官方网站。
- 选择产品:在首页点击“产品”选项卡,然后选择“WPS Office”,接着点击右下角的“免费试用版”链接。
- 下载安装包:在弹出的新窗口中,点击页面顶部的“立即下载”按钮,下载对应的WPS Office安装包。
- 运行安装程序:双击下载好的安装包文件,按照提示完成安装过程,安装完成后,点击桌面图标启动WPS Office。
- 激活账号:如果尚未激活,需前往WPS Office官网注册账户并登录后才能使用相关功能。
常见问题解决:
- 安装失败:若遇到安装失败的情况,检查网络连接是否正常,或者尝试重启电脑重新安装。
- 权限不足:部分用户可能会遇到因权限问题导致无法正常使用的情况,请确保当前用户拥有相应的管理员权限。
基本VBA编程基础
创建第一个VBA宏:
- 打开WPS Office中的任意文档,按下
Alt + F11
键打开VBA编辑器。 - 在左侧的“库”面板中找到“Microsoft Excel对象库”或“Microsoft Word对象库”,选择其中一个。
- 右键单击空白区域,在弹出菜单中选择“插入” > “模块”命令,创建一个新的模块以存放您的宏代码。
- 输入以下代码示例:
Sub SampleMacro() MsgBox "Hello, World!" End Sub
运行此宏时会弹出一个消息框显示“Hello, World!”。
使用宏执行基本操作:
-
复制粘贴:在VBA中可以使用类似Excel的函数来实现复制和粘贴功能。
Dim sourceRange As Range Set sourceRange = ActiveSheet.Range("A1:C3") ' 复制源范围 Application.CutCopyMode = False sourceRange.Copy Dim destinationRange As Range Set destinationRange = ActiveSheet.Range("D1:F4") ' 粘贴到目标位置 destinationRange.PasteSpecial Paste:=xlPasteValues
实际应用案例
实践应用:
-
数据筛选与排序:
使用VBA编写代码对表格中的数据进行筛选和排序,从而简化数据分析工作。
-
自动填充:
利用宏实现数据自动填充功能,比如批量输入相同格式的日期、数值等。
示例代码:
Sub AutoFillDates() Dim cell As Range For Each cell In Range("B:B").Cells If IsDate(cell.Value) Then cell.Offset(0, 1).Value = DateSerial(Application.WorksheetFunction.Year(cell), Application.WorksheetFunction.Month(cell), 1) Else cell.Offset(0, 1).Value = "" End If Next cell End Sub
这段代码会在指定列(B列)中的非空日期单元格旁边添加对应日期的月份名称。
通过以上步骤,您已经成功下载了WPS VBA插件,并掌握了基本的VBA编程技巧,您可以根据自身需求,继续学习更多高级功能及应用场景,进一步提升工作效率,WPS VBA不仅是一个强大的数据处理工具,更是实现自动化办公不可或缺的一部分,期待您在实践中不断发现新的可能!